Ticketfly’s Purchase Questions give promoters the ability to gather valuable customer information during the ticket buying process.
What’s so cool about questions?
Let’s say you run a charity event, conference, festival, or amusement park and you’re selling tickets with us. Purchase Questions make it easy for you to find out how customers heard about an event, collect t-shirt sizes, gather age information, or confirm whether or not customers are *really* ready to ride that new upside-down coaster. Music promoters can use questions for all kinds of things! You can get feedback about your club, run fan giveaways, find out which new beer your customers would like on tap, collect additional contact info, and more.
How does it work?
Now when you build your event on Ticketfly, you can create open questions, multiple choice questions, or contact fields that will show up when fans buy tickets. Make them either optional or required. After the event, you can view collected info in your account or filter and export it for later use! And everything happens in Ticketfly’s Backstage content management system; you won’t need a 3rd party survey service.

Often touted the music lover’s mecca, Preservation Hall was founded in 1961 to protect the honor of New Orleans Jazz which had lost popularity to modern jazz and rock ‘n’ roll. According to a fan on Yelp, “This is the only venue in New Orleans where music wasn’t blasted at us from speakers…there are no amps, mics, or ringing in the ears, just pure and simple jazz.”

In the oldest and most famous neighborhood in New Orleans, known as the Vieux Carre or French Quarter, Jax Brewery Bistro Bar is one to keep on your radar. The venue offers a nice mix with a laid-back bar downstairs and a club atmosphere upstairs. Take your drinks outside on the patio and enjoy the beautiful view of the Mississippi River. Oh, here’s a bit of interesting trivia, it used to be the old Ripley Believe It Or Not!
